Zadania Monitora zdarzeń WMI
Instrumentacja zarządzania Windows Zadań Monitor zdarzeń zegarki dla Instrumentacja zarządzania Windows (Instrumentacja zarządzania Windows) przy użyciu kwerendy zdarzenia języka kwerendy Instrumentacji zarządzania (WQL) aby określić zdarzenia interesu zdarzenia.Monitor zdarzeń WMI zadań można użyć dla następujących celów:
Poczekaj, aż powiadomienie, że pliki zostały dodane do folderu, a następnie zainicjować przetwarzania pliku.
Uruchom pakiet, który usuwa pliki, gdy dostępnej pamięci na serwerze spadnie niższe od określonej wartości procentowej.
Obserwuj instalacji aplikacji, a następnie uruchom pakiet, który używa aplikacji.
Zadanie czytnik danych WMI można skonfigurować w następujący sposób:
Określ menedżer połączeń usługi WMI do używania.
Określ źródło kwerendy WQL.źródło Może być zewnętrzny zadania, zmienna lub pliku lub kwerendy mogą być przechowywane we właściwość zadania.
Określ akcja wykonywaną przez zadanie po wystąpieniu zdarzenie WMI.Można rejestrować powiadomienie o zdarzeniu i stan po zdarzeń lub niestandardowe podnoszenie Integration Services zdarzenie, które dostarczają informacji skojarzonych z zdarzeń WMI, powiadomienia i stan po zdarzeń.
Definiowanie, jak zadanie reaguje zdarzenie.Zadania mogą być konfigurowane do się pomyślnie lub nie powiedzie się, w zależności od przypadku, lub zadania można tylko oglądać zdarzenie ponownie.
Określ akcja ma zadanie, gdy limit czasu kwerendy WMI.Można rejestrować czas-out i stan po czas-out lub podnieść niestandardowy Integration Services zdarzeń, co oznacza, że zdarzeń WMI czasrejestrowanie i wyjście d czas-out i czas-poza stan.
Definiowanie, jak zadanie reaguje na czas-limit.Zadania mogą być konfigurowane do się pomyślnie lub nie powiedzie się lub zadania można tylko oglądać zdarzenie ponownie.
Określ ile razy zadanie oczekuje na zdarzenie.
Określ czas-limit.
Jeśli źródło jest plikiem, zadanie Monitor zdarzeń WMI używa menedżer połączeń do pliku, aby połączyć się z pliku.Aby uzyskać więcej informacji, zobacz Płaski Menedżera połączeń do pliku.
Zadania Monitora zdarzeń WMI używa menedżer połączeń usługi WMI do połączenia z serwerem, z którego odczytuje informacje WMI.Aby uzyskać więcej informacji, zobacz Menedżer połączeń usługi WMI.
Kwerendy WQL
WQL jest dialekt SQL z rozszerzeniami do obsługi WMI powiadomienie o zdarzeniu i innych funkcji specyficznych dla usługi WMI.Aby uzyskać więcej informacji na temat WQL, zobacz dokumentację Instrumentacja zarządzania Windows, w msdn Library.
Ostrzeżenie
Klasy WMI różnić od wersji systemu Windows.Te przykładowe kwerendy są prawidłowe w systemie Windows XP, ale może być nieprawidłowy w starszych wersjach systemu Windows.
Następująca kwerenda oczekuje na powiadomienie, że użycie Procesora jest więcej niż 40 procent.
SELECT * from __InstanceModificationEvent WITHIN 2 WHERE TargetInstance ISA 'Win32_Processor' and TargetInstance.LoadPercentage > 40
Następująca kwerenda oczekuje na powiadomienie, że plik został dodany do folderu.
SELECT * FROM __InstanceCreationEvent WITHIN 10 WHERE TargetInstance ISA "CIM_DirectoryContainsFile" and TargetInstance.GroupComponent= "Win32_Directory.Name=\"c:\\\\WMIFileWatcher\""
Inne zadania pokrewne
Integration Services obejmuje zadania, który czyta informacje WMI.
Aby uzyskać więcej informacji dotyczących tego zadania kliknij następujący temat:
Zadania Monitora zdarzeń WMI niestandardowych komunikatów rejestrowania
W poniższej tabela przedstawiono wpisy dziennika niestandardowego zadania Monitor zdarzeń WMI.Aby uzyskać więcej informacji, zobacz Implementowanie rejestrowania w opakowaniach i Niestandardowe komunikaty do rejestrowania.
Wpis dziennika |
Opis |
---|---|
WMIEventWatcherEventOccurred |
Wskazuje, że wystąpiło zdarzenie, że zadanie zostało monitorowania. |
WMIEventWatcherTimedout |
Wskazuje, że zadania został przekroczony. |
WMIEventWatcherWatchingForWMIEvents |
Wskazuje, że do chwili rozpoczęcia zadania wykonać kwerendy WQL.Wpis zawiera kwerendę. |
Konfigurowanie zadań Monitor zdarzeń WMI
zestaw właściwości poprzez SSIS Projektant lub programowo.
Aby uzyskać więcej informacji na temat właściwości, które zestaw w SSIS Projektant, kliknij jeden z następujących tematów:
Aby uzyskać więcej informacji dotyczących sposobu zestaw tych właściwości w SSIS Projektant, kliknij następujący temat:
Konfigurowanie zadań Monitor zdarzeń WMI programowo
Aby uzyskać więcej informacji na temat programowo ustawienie tych właściwości kliknij następujący temat:
- [ T:Microsoft.SqlServer.Dts.Tasks.WmiEventWatcherTask.WmiEventWatcherTask ]
|